The Xiaomi 15 Ultra was launched on February 27, 2025. It is Xiaomi’s top-end flagship phone with cutting-edge features, premium design, and powerful performance.
Important Considerations
-
Equipped with Snapdragon 8 Elite chipset and up to 16GB RAM, making it one of the fastest phones in the market.
-
Supports up to 1TB storage but no microSD card expansion.
-
Features IP68 water and dust resistance and aerospace-grade glass fiber build.
-
The phone comes with Leica-tuned cameras capable of 8K video recording.
-
Ships with Android 15 + HyperOS 2, with 4 major Android upgrades promised.
-
Price is premium, so buyers looking for budget or midrange phones should consider alternatives.

Specs Overview
The Xiaomi 15 Ultra has a 6.73-inch LTPO AMOLED display with 120Hz refresh rate, Dolby Vision, HDR10+, HDR Vivid, and up to 3200 nits peak brightness. It is powered by the Snapdragon 8 Elite chipset with Adreno 830 GPU, paired with 12GB/16GB RAM and 256GB/512GB/1TB storage (no card slot). The rear camera setup includes 50MP + 50MP + 200MP + 50MP Leica lenses with 8K video support, while the front camera is 32MP with up to 4K recording. It comes with an under-display ultrasonic fingerprint sensor, runs on Android 15 with HyperOS 2, and supports 5G, WiFi, Bluetooth 6.0, and USB Type-C 3.2.
